SimpleBinaryCalculator

This is a simple Java based binary calculator based on software emulated gates. Our application will support up to 8 bit binary values supporting addition and subtraction of any value within 8 bits.

The project is split into three portions:

  • The Adder
  • The Complementor
  • The Registers

Each of these systems will be developed in a separate branch and merged when each branch has completed their work.

Data Exchange between classes

  • Any data that will be exchanged between two or more parts of the program will be sent as an array of 8 boolean values.
  • True representing a 1 and false representing a 0 in bolean values.
  • The left most column of the array, position 0 in Java will represent the most significant digit of our binary number.

Expectations of classes

  • The adder will blindly add any two numbers and return the result in an array

    • If the application is subtracting two numbers the adder will be passed a properly sighned value so that the resulltant is correct
  • The complementor will perform any complemtning steps necesary as well as performing a twos complement operation if subtraction is to be carried out

  • The register will support three different registers

    • The subtrahend or addend
    • The minuend or addend
    • The summand
